|
I can not compile trunk anymore, looks as if code from the GSOC branch was
committed here? Building CXX object digikam/CMakeFiles/digikamdatabase.dir/__/libs/database/schemaupdater.o [ 49%] Built target digikamimageplugin_fxfilters /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p: In member function ‘bool Digikam::SchemaUpdater::makeUpdates()’: /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:258:31: error: ‘updateV4toV5’ was not declared in this scope /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p: In member function ‘bool Digikam::SchemaUpdater::createDatabase()’: /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:365:25: error: ‘createTablesV5’ was not declared in this scope /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:366:29: error: ‘createIndicesV5’ was not declared in this scope /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:367:30: error: ‘createTriggersV5’ was not declared in this scope /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p: At global scope: /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:385:36: error: no ‘bool Digikam::SchemaUpdater::createTablesV5()’ member function declared in class ‘Digikam::SchemaUpdater’ /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:394:37: error: no ‘bool Digikam::SchemaUpdater::createIndicesV5()’ member function declared in class ‘Digikam::SchemaUpdater’ /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:405:38: error: no ‘bool Digikam::SchemaUpdater::createTriggersV5()’ member function declared in class ‘Digikam::SchemaUpdater’ /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:516:34: error: no ‘bool Digikam::SchemaUpdater::updateV4toV5()’ member function declared in class ‘Digikam::SchemaUpdater’ /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p: In member function ‘bool Digikam::SchemaUpdater::createDatabase()’: /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:383:1: warning: control reaches end of non-void function /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p: At global scope: /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:492:20: warning: ‘QStringList Digikam::cleanUserFilterString(const QString&)’ defined but not used make[2]: *** [digikam/CMakeFiles/digikamdatabase.dir/__/libs/database/schemaupdater.o] Error 1 make[1]: *** [digikam/CMakeFiles/digikamdatabase.dir/all] Error 2 make: *** [all] Error 2 Andi _______________________________________________ Digikam-devel mailing list [hidden email] https://mail.kde.org/mailman/listinfo/digikam-devel |
|
Andi,
I think no. Nobody has touch this file since 3 month. Gilles 2010/7/20 Andi Clemens <[hidden email]>: > I can not compile trunk anymore, looks as if code from the GSOC branch was > committed here? > > Building CXX object > digikam/CMakeFiles/digikamdatabase.dir/__/libs/database/schemaupdater.o > [ 49%] Built target digikamimageplugin_fxfilters > /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p: In > member function ‘bool Digikam::SchemaUpdater::makeUpdates()’: > /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:258:31: > error: ‘updateV4toV5’ was not declared in this scope > /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p: In > member function ‘bool Digikam::SchemaUpdater::createDatabase()’: > /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:365:25: > error: ‘createTablesV5’ was not declared in this scope > /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:366:29: > error: ‘createIndicesV5’ was not declared in this scope > /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:367:30: > error: ‘createTriggersV5’ was not declared in this scope > /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p: At > global scope: > /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:385:36: > error: no ‘bool Digikam::SchemaUpdater::createTablesV5()’ member function > declared in class ‘Digikam::SchemaUpdater’ > /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:394:37: > error: no ‘bool Digikam::SchemaUpdater::createIndicesV5()’ member function > declared in class ‘Digikam::SchemaUpdater’ > /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:405:38: > error: no ‘bool Digikam::SchemaUpdater::createTriggersV5()’ member function > declared in class ‘Digikam::SchemaUpdater’ > /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:516:34: > error: no ‘bool Digikam::SchemaUpdater::updateV4toV5()’ member function > declared in class ‘Digikam::SchemaUpdater’ > /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p: In > member function ‘bool Digikam::SchemaUpdater::createDatabase()’: > /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:383:1: > warning: control reaches end of non-void function > /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p: At > global scope: > /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:492:20: > warning: ‘QStringList Digikam::cleanUserFilterString(const QString&)’ defined > but not used > make[2]: *** > [digikam/CMakeFiles/digikamdatabase.dir/__/libs/database/schemaupdater.o] > Error 1 > make[1]: *** [digikam/CMakeFiles/digikamdatabase.dir/all] Error 2 > make: *** [all] Error 2 > > > Andi > _______________________________________________ > Digikam-devel mailing list > [hidden email] > https://mail.kde.org/mailman/listinfo/digikam-devel > Digikam-devel mailing list [hidden email] https://mail.kde.org/mailman/listinfo/digikam-devel |
|
Hum, i understand... Look there ;
http://websvn.kde.org/trunk/extragear/graphics/digikam/libs/database/schemaupdater.h?r1=1109189&r2=1151849 Holger has patched schemaupdater.h but not schemaupdater.cpp This is why it do not compile... 2010/7/20 Gilles Caulier <[hidden email]>: > Andi, > > I think no. > > Nobody has touch this file since 3 month. > > Gilles > > 2010/7/20 Andi Clemens <[hidden email]>: >> I can not compile trunk anymore, looks as if code from the GSOC branch was >> committed here? >> >> Building CXX object >> digikam/CMakeFiles/digikamdatabase.dir/__/libs/database/schemaupdater.o >> [ 49%] Built target digikamimageplugin_fxfilters >> /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p: In >> member function ‘bool Digikam::SchemaUpdater::makeUpdates()’: >> /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:258:31: >> error: ‘updateV4toV5’ was not declared in this scope >> /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p: In >> member function ‘bool Digikam::SchemaUpdater::createDatabase()’: >> /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:365:25: >> error: ‘createTablesV5’ was not declared in this scope >> /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:366:29: >> error: ‘createIndicesV5’ was not declared in this scope >> /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:367:30: >> error: ‘createTriggersV5’ was not declared in this scope >> /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p: At >> global scope: >> /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:385:36: >> error: no ‘bool Digikam::SchemaUpdater::createTablesV5()’ member function >> declared in class ‘Digikam::SchemaUpdater’ >> /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:394:37: >> error: no ‘bool Digikam::SchemaUpdater::createIndicesV5()’ member function >> declared in class ‘Digikam::SchemaUpdater’ >> /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:405:38: >> error: no ‘bool Digikam::SchemaUpdater::createTriggersV5()’ member function >> declared in class ‘Digikam::SchemaUpdater’ >> /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:516:34: >> error: no ‘bool Digikam::SchemaUpdater::updateV4toV5()’ member function >> declared in class ‘Digikam::SchemaUpdater’ >> /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p: In >> member function ‘bool Digikam::SchemaUpdater::createDatabase()’: >> /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:383:1: >> warning: control reaches end of non-void function >> /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p: At >> global scope: >> /home/andi/Programmieren/KDE/digikam/libs/database/schemaupdater.cpp:492:20: >> warning: ‘QStringList Digikam::cleanUserFilterString(const QString&)’ defined >> but not used >> make[2]: *** >> [digikam/CMakeFiles/digikamdatabase.dir/__/libs/database/schemaupdater.o] >> Error 1 >> make[1]: *** [digikam/CMakeFiles/digikamdatabase.dir/all] Error 2 >> make: *** [all] Error 2 >> >> >> Andi >> _______________________________________________ >> Digikam-devel mailing list >> [hidden email] >> https://mail.kde.org/mailman/listinfo/digikam-devel >> > Digikam-devel mailing list [hidden email] https://mail.kde.org/mailman/listinfo/digikam-devel |
|
In reply to this post by Bugzilla from andi.clemens@gmx.net
Hi,
sorry, I overlooked that file. It should not (yet) checked in into the trunk. I reverted the file to the previous revision and compiled the project successfully as a test. -- Holger _______________________________________________ Digikam-devel mailing list [hidden email] https://mail.kde.org/mailman/listinfo/digikam-devel |
| Free forum by Nabble | Edit this page |
